inculcation
/ˌɪnkʌlˈkeɪʃən/
noun
- The process of teaching or impressing an idea, attitude, or habit through persistent instruction or repetition.
- The program focuses on the inculcation of values like honesty and teamwork.
- The inculcation of good study habits early in life can lead to academic success.
- Through the inculcation of safety rules, the factory reduced its accident rate.
